gi-gtk-0.3.18.13: Gtk bindings

CopyrightWill Thompson, Iñaki García Etxebarria and Jonas Platte
LicenseLGPL-2.1
MaintainerIñaki García Etxebarria (garetxe@gmail.com)
Safe HaskellNone
LanguageHaskell2010

GI.Gtk.Objects.ComboBox

Contents

Description

 

Synopsis

Exported types

newtype ComboBox Source

Constructors

ComboBox (ForeignPtr ComboBox) 

Instances

GObject ComboBox Source 
((~) * info (ResolveComboBoxMethod t ComboBox), MethodInfo * info ComboBox p) => IsLabel t (ComboBox -> p) Source 

Methods

fromLabel :: Proxy# Symbol t -> ComboBox -> p

((~) * info (ResolveComboBoxMethod t ComboBox), MethodInfo * info ComboBox p) => IsLabelProxy t (ComboBox -> p) Source 

Methods

fromLabelProxy :: Proxy Symbol t -> ComboBox -> p

type ParentTypes ComboBox Source 
type AttributeList ComboBox Source 
type SignalList ComboBox Source 

Methods

comboBoxGetActive

comboBoxGetActiveId

comboBoxGetActiveIter

comboBoxGetAddTearoffs

comboBoxGetAddTearoffs :: (MonadIO m, ComboBoxK a) => a -> m Bool Source

Deprecated: (Since version 3.10)

comboBoxGetButtonSensitivity

comboBoxGetColumnSpanColumn

comboBoxGetEntryTextColumn

comboBoxGetFocusOnClick

comboBoxGetHasEntry

comboBoxGetIdColumn

comboBoxGetModel

comboBoxGetPopupAccessible

comboBoxGetPopupFixedWidth

comboBoxGetRowSpanColumn

comboBoxGetTitle

comboBoxGetTitle :: (MonadIO m, ComboBoxK a) => a -> m Text Source

Deprecated: (Since version 3.10)

comboBoxGetWrapWidth

comboBoxNew

comboBoxNewWithArea

comboBoxNewWithAreaAndEntry

comboBoxNewWithEntry

comboBoxNewWithModel

comboBoxNewWithModelAndEntry

comboBoxPopdown

comboBoxPopdown :: (MonadIO m, ComboBoxK a) => a -> m () Source

comboBoxPopup

data ComboBoxPopupMethodInfo Source

Instances

((~) (TYPE Lifted) signature (m ()), MonadIO m, ComboBoxK a) => MethodInfo (TYPE Lifted) ComboBoxPopupMethodInfo a signature Source 

comboBoxPopup :: (MonadIO m, ComboBoxK a) => a -> m () Source

comboBoxPopupForDevice

data ComboBoxPopupForDeviceMethodInfo Source

Instances

((~) (TYPE Lifted) signature (b -> m ()), MonadIO m, ComboBoxK a, DeviceK b) => MethodInfo (TYPE Lifted) ComboBoxPopupForDeviceMethodInfo a signature Source 

comboBoxPopupForDevice :: (MonadIO m, ComboBoxK a, DeviceK b) => a -> b -> m () Source

comboBoxSetActive

comboBoxSetActive :: (MonadIO m, ComboBoxK a) => a -> Int32 -> m () Source

comboBoxSetActiveId

comboBoxSetActiveIter

comboBoxSetAddTearoffs

comboBoxSetAddTearoffs :: (MonadIO m, ComboBoxK a) => a -> Bool -> m () Source

Deprecated: (Since version 3.10)

comboBoxSetButtonSensitivity

comboBoxSetColumnSpanColumn

comboBoxSetEntryTextColumn

comboBoxSetFocusOnClick

comboBoxSetIdColumn

comboBoxSetModel

comboBoxSetModel :: (MonadIO m, ComboBoxK a, TreeModelK b) => a -> Maybe b -> m () Source

comboBoxSetPopupFixedWidth

comboBoxSetRowSeparatorFunc

comboBoxSetRowSpanColumn

comboBoxSetTitle

comboBoxSetTitle :: (MonadIO m, ComboBoxK a) => a -> Text -> m () Source

Deprecated: (Since version 3.10)

comboBoxSetWrapWidth

Properties

Active

setComboBoxActive :: (MonadIO m, ComboBoxK o) => o -> Int32 -> m () Source

ActiveId

setComboBoxActiveId :: (MonadIO m, ComboBoxK o) => o -> Text -> m () Source

AddTearoffs

ButtonSensitivity

data ComboBoxButtonSensitivityPropertyInfo Source

Instances

AttrInfo ComboBoxButtonSensitivityPropertyInfo Source 
type AttrLabel ComboBoxButtonSensitivityPropertyInfo = "button-sensitivity" Source 
type AttrGetType ComboBoxButtonSensitivityPropertyInfo = SensitivityType Source 
type AttrBaseTypeConstraint ComboBoxButtonSensitivityPropertyInfo = ComboBoxK Source 
type AttrSetTypeConstraint ComboBoxButtonSensitivityPropertyInfo = TYPE Lifted ~ SensitivityType Source 
type AttrAllowedOps ComboBoxButtonSensitivityPropertyInfo = (:) AttrOpTag AttrSet ((:) AttrOpTag AttrConstruct ((:) AttrOpTag AttrGet ([] AttrOpTag))) Source 

CellArea

ColumnSpanColumn

data ComboBoxColumnSpanColumnPropertyInfo Source

EntryTextColumn

data ComboBoxEntryTextColumnPropertyInfo Source

FocusOnClick

HasEntry

HasFrame

setComboBoxHasFrame :: (MonadIO m, ComboBoxK o) => o -> Bool -> m () Source

IdColumn

Model

setComboBoxModel :: (MonadIO m, ComboBoxK o, TreeModelK a) => o -> a -> m () Source

PopupFixedWidth

data ComboBoxPopupFixedWidthPropertyInfo Source

PopupShown

RowSpanColumn

TearoffTitle

WrapWidth

Signals

Changed

type ComboBoxChangedCallbackC = Ptr () -> Ptr () -> IO () Source

FormatEntryText

MoveActive

Popdown

Popup

type ComboBoxPopupCallbackC = Ptr () -> Ptr () -> IO () Source